Transaction 51d0ba0f0a29c205145b931c4a73bf6dff442ee694ce2ee057c9021f8a6de7bd
1 Input
1 Output
-
51d0ba0f0a29c205145b931c4a73bf6dff442ee694ce2ee057c9021f8a6de7bd:0
- value
- 24506
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8e0124046047935d3ae770371cdd93a776bf673 OP_EQUAL
- address
- 3JYYgazjNxwdzHtFxXAUYM1yzSrMNnyAc2